For immediate release - December 18, 2003

JDS Uniphase Employee Group Donates $15 Million - The Largest Donation to Healthcare in Ottawa History

(OTTAWA, ONTARIO) – A group of current and former JDS Uniphase employees have come together to donate $15 million to The Ottawa Hospital, the biggest one-time gift to the hospital – and to healthcare – in Ottawa history.

Jozef Straus, one of the founders of JDS Uniphase and Co-chair of The Ottawa Hospital Foundation’s Legacy Campaign, spearheaded the effort to bring together this generous group of donors. The gift will go towards the long-awaited $75 million Critical Care Wing at the General Campus of The Ottawa Hospital. The new facility, to be named the JDS Uniphase Employee Legacy Critical Care Wing, will provide The Ottawa Hospital the capacity to service the growing healthcare needs in Eastern Ontario. The wing will have 17 new, state of the art operating rooms, 32 Intensive Care Unit beds, 36 recovery room beds, a new surgical day care unit, and a variety of support areas and offices. Construction is expected to begin in the spring of 2004.

“The staff and patients of The Ottawa Hospital, as well as members of our community, are all grateful to this group of donors,“ said Dr. Jack Kitts, President and CEO of The Ottawa Hospital. “This gift will touch the lives of hundreds of thousands of people in this region for decades to come.“

“I am very proud of this group,“ said Jozef Straus of his fellow donors. “The success of our fundraising effort demonstrates the energy, generosity, and humanity of all those involved. We are part of a team that is forever bonded by our unique experience at JDS Uniphase. We made a real difference. We wanted to come together and do that again, this time by supporting healthcare in Ottawa.”

“We are making a donation on behalf of the entire JDS Uniphase community,“ said Yves Tremblay, one of the JDS Uniphase donors and member of The Ottawa Hospital’s Board of Governors. “Everyone who has been with JDS Uniphase should be proud of this effort and feel part of it. By making this gift public today, we’re reaching out to the broader JDS Uniphase community, past and present, to inspire others to be part of this fundraising effort.”

The Ottawa Hospital Foundation’s Legacy Campaign is a five-year, $100 million effort to improve healthcare and research at The Ottawa Hospital. This $15 million donation announcement brings the campaign total to the halfway mark of $50 million, less than two years after the campaign began.

“This is a new type of philanthropy,“ said Susan Doyle, President and CEO of The Ottawa Hospital Foundation. “It is the first time that a group of donors has come together in this way and given so much. We are very fortunate to have a group of people who are so committed to improving healthcare in our community."

With its 1,130 beds, The Ottawa Hospital is one of the largest teaching hospitals in Canada and one of the Ottawa area’s largest employers. It provides comprehensive, high quality, patient-focused health care services, in English and French, to over 1.5 million residents of Eastern Ontario, and specialized and complex services for residents of Northeastern Ontario.
